Definition
"Omnipresent" describes something or someone that is present everywhere at the same time. It is often used to express the idea of being universally present or constantly encountered, such as in the sentence: 'Technology is omnipresent in almost all aspects of modern life.'
Etymology
The word "omnipresent" comes from the Latin roots 'omni-' meaning 'all' and 'praesens' meaning 'present.' Together, they literally mean 'present everywhere.' Did you know that this concept has been used in philosophical and religious contexts to describe deities or forces that are everywhere simultaneously?
